Your rights when you're towed in Pennsylvania

Towing is regulated at the state and city level, and the protections are stronger than most drivers realize. Commonly: non-consent tow rates are capped or must be published, you can't be towed from private property unless signage meets local rules, you have the right to an itemized invoice, and many jurisdictions require operators to accept card payment and release personal property from the vehicle. If a charge looks wrong, ask for the itemized invoice first and escalate to the state or city agency that licenses towing.

Stuck on the highway?

If you break down on the interstate: get as far onto the shoulder as possible, hazards on, exit on the passenger side and stand well away behind the barrier. Never accept a tow from a truck that shows up unsolicited at a collision - you choose your operator and your destination, and 'accident chasers' are exactly what towing regulations exist to stop.

What towing costs here

Around Stroudsburg, expect a hook-up fee of about $50–$125 (typical $75) plus $2.75–$5.62 per mile for a standard light-duty tow. Nights, storms, winching and heavy vehicles cost more. Always ask for the all-in price before the truck rolls.

Jump start$75
Lockout$75
Tire change$75
Fuel delivery$30
Winch-out$100

Based on published prices from towing websites in this state (median shown; state, regional or national data as available).
